Augusta at Pelican Marsh Homes in North Naples
Augusta at Pelican Marsh is a private residential neighborhood in North Naples where mature landscaping, quiet streets, and attractive single-family homes create a comfortable sense of place. The community appeals to buyers who want the privacy of a gated neighborhood while staying close to beaches, shopping, dining, healthcare, and the recreational opportunities found throughout Pelican Marsh.
Homes in Augusta are designed for everyday comfort rather than show alone. Many offer open living areas, generous bedroom suites, attached garages, screened lanais, private pools, and views of landscaped grounds, lakes, preserves, or golf course surroundings.

A Central North Naples Location
Mercato, Waterside Shops, Artis–Naples, grocery stores, restaurants, medical facilities, and everyday services are all within easy reach of Pelican Marsh. Residents also have practical access to downtown Naples, Bonita Springs, Estero, and Southwest Florida International Airport.
The neighborhood’s location is especially attractive to buyers who want a golf community address without being far from the Gulf of Mexico or North Naples commercial areas.
Close to Vanderbilt Beach and Gulf Recreation
Augusta residents are a short drive from Vanderbilt Beach, Clam Pass, and Delnor-Wiggins Pass State Park. Boating, fishing, waterfront dining, beach walks, and Gulf sunsets are all part of the broader North Naples lifestyle.

Association Fees and Ownership Costs
The complete cost of owning a home in Augusta may include neighborhood and master association fees, optional club expenses, property taxes, insurance, utilities, landscaping, pool care, maintenance, assessments, and transfer-related charges.
Buyers should confirm which services are included in current fees and which remain the owner’s responsibility. Association budgets, governing documents, insurance information, meeting records, and planned projects should be reviewed before purchasing.
What Buyers Should Review
Before buying in Augusta, purchasers should examine applicable homeowners association documents, architectural guidelines, rental restrictions, pet rules, maintenance responsibilities, approval procedures, and any limits involving exterior alterations or property use.
The home itself should also be professionally inspected. Important areas include the roof, air conditioning, plumbing, electrical systems, windows, doors, storm protection, pool equipment, drainage, appliances, landscaping, and renovations completed by previous owners.
